4951-4968 of 8,639 vehicles
£11,990
£27,745
£10,855
£10,995
£11,495
£8,295
£9,995
£6,675
£29,310
£26,310
£27,012
£30,610
£54,998
£54,988
£29,998
£17,888
£9,750
£32,020